In a major political development, the Syrian government has announced a complete and immediate ceasefire across the country. The presidency issued an official statement calling upon all citizens to come together to support the national peace initiative and help restore stability. The decision is being hailed as a critical step toward ending years of devastating conflict.
The declaration emphasizes the government’s commitment to national reconciliation and rebuilding efforts. “It is time to pave the way for the Syrian State to rise strong again,” the statement read, urging communities, opposition groups, and displaced citizens to return to peaceful coexistence. The move aims to create a conducive environment for dialogue and reconstruction.
International observers and humanitarian agencies have cautiously welcomed the announcement, though skepticism remains due to the fragile nature of past truces. Still, the promise of a permanent halt to hostilities has sparked hope for renewed diplomatic efforts and humanitarian access in war-torn regions.
The ceasefire comes amid ongoing regional negotiations and mounting pressure from international bodies to find a political resolution. Whether this ceasefire holds remains to be seen, but for now, millions of Syrians are holding on to a rare glimmer of hope in their long pursuit of peace.
